|
Derivative Instruments and Hedging Activities - Notionals of Derivative Contracts (Details) - USD ($)
$ in Billions
|
Jun. 30, 2019
|
Dec. 31, 2018
|Derivatives, Notional Amount
|Derivative assets
|$ 18,794
|$ 16,457
|Derivative liabilities
|18,704
|15,522
|Bilateral OTC
|Derivatives, Notional Amount
|Derivative assets
|8,317
|7,895
|Derivative liabilities
|8,407
|8,027
|Cleared OTC
|Derivatives, Notional Amount
|Derivative assets
|8,932
|6,953
|Derivative liabilities
|8,801
|6,030
|Exchange- Traded
|Derivatives, Notional Amount
|Derivative assets
|1,545
|1,609
|Derivative liabilities
|1,496
|1,465
|Designated as accounting hedges
|Derivatives, Notional Amount
|Derivative assets
|147
|73
|Derivative liabilities
|40
|115
|Designated as accounting hedges |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|146
|67
|Derivative liabilities
|29
|109
|Designated as accounting hedges |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|1
|6
|Derivative liabilities
|11
|6
|Designated as accounting hedges | Bilateral OTC
|Derivatives, Notional Amount
|Derivative assets
|14
|20
|Derivative liabilities
|10
|7
|Designated as accounting hedges | Bilateral OTC |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|14
|15
|Derivative liabilities
|0
|2
|Designated as accounting hedges | Bilateral OTC |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|0
|5
|Derivative liabilities
|10
|5
|Designated as accounting hedges | Cleared OTC
|Derivatives, Notional Amount
|Derivative assets
|133
|53
|Derivative liabilities
|30
|108
|Designated as accounting hedges | Cleared OTC |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|132
|52
|Derivative liabilities
|29
|107
|Designated as accounting hedges | Cleared OTC |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|1
|1
|Derivative liabilities
|1
|1
|Designated as accounting hedges | Exchange- Traded
|Derivatives, Notional Amount
|Derivative assets
|0
|0
|Derivative liabilities
|0
|0
|Designated as accounting hedges | Exchange- Traded |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|0
|0
|Derivative liabilities
|0
|0
|Designated as accounting hedges | Exchange- Traded |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|0
|0
|Derivative liabilities
|0
|0
|Not designated as accounting hedges
|Derivatives, Notional Amount
|Derivative assets
|18,647
|16,384
|Derivative liabilities
|18,664
|15,407
|Not designated as accounting hedges |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|14,580
|12,672
|Derivative liabilities
|14,416
|11,462
|Not designated as accounting hedges | Credit
|Derivatives, Notional Amount
|Derivative assets
|192
|236
|Derivative liabilities
|218
|235
|Not designated as accounting hedges |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|2,899
|2,568
|Derivative liabilities
|3,007
|2,582
|Not designated as accounting hedges | Equity
|Derivatives, Notional Amount
|Derivative assets
|806
|744
|Derivative liabilities
|867
|991
|Not designated as accounting hedges | Commodity and other
|Derivatives, Notional Amount
|Derivative assets
|170
|164
|Derivative liabilities
|156
|137
|Not designated as accounting hedges | Bilateral OTC
|Derivatives, Notional Amount
|Derivative assets
|8,303
|7,875
|Derivative liabilities
|8,397
|8,020
|Not designated as accounting hedges | Bilateral OTC |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|4,899
|4,807
|Derivative liabilities
|4,876
|4,946
|Not designated as accounting hedges | Bilateral OTC | Credit
|Derivatives, Notional Amount
|Derivative assets
|121
|162
|Derivative liabilities
|139
|162
|Not designated as accounting hedges | Bilateral OTC |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|2,781
|2,436
|Derivative liabilities
|2,885
|2,451
|Not designated as accounting hedges | Bilateral OTC | Equity
|Derivatives, Notional Amount
|Derivative assets
|402
|373
|Derivative liabilities
|407
|389
|Not designated as accounting hedges | Bilateral OTC | Commodity and other
|Derivatives, Notional Amount
|Derivative assets
|100
|97
|Derivative liabilities
|90
|72
|Not designated as accounting hedges | Cleared OTC
|Derivatives, Notional Amount
|Derivative assets
|8,799
|6,900
|Derivative liabilities
|8,771
|5,922
|Not designated as accounting hedges | Cleared OTC |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|8,622
|6,708
|Derivative liabilities
|8,583
|5,735
|Not designated as accounting hedges | Cleared OTC | Credit
|Derivatives, Notional Amount
|Derivative assets
|71
|74
|Derivative liabilities
|79
|73
|Not designated as accounting hedges | Cleared OTC |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|106
|118
|Derivative liabilities
|109
|114
|Not designated as accounting hedges | Cleared OTC | Equity
|Derivatives, Notional Amount
|Derivative assets
|0
|0
|Derivative liabilities
|0
|0
|Not designated as accounting hedges | Cleared OTC | Commodity and other
|Derivatives, Notional Amount
|Derivative assets
|0
|0
|Derivative liabilities
|0
|0
|Not designated as accounting hedges | Exchange- Traded
|Derivatives, Notional Amount
|Derivative assets
|1,545
|1,609
|Derivative liabilities
|1,496
|1,465
|Not designated as accounting hedges | Exchange- Traded | Interest rate
|Derivatives, Notional Amount
|Derivative assets
|1,059
|1,157
|Derivative liabilities
|957
|781
|Not designated as accounting hedges | Exchange- Traded | Credit
|Derivatives, Notional Amount
|Derivative assets
|0
|0
|Derivative liabilities
|0
|0
|Not designated as accounting hedges | Exchange- Traded | Foreign exchange
|Derivatives, Notional Amount
|Derivative assets
|12
|14
|Derivative liabilities
|13
|17
|Not designated as accounting hedges | Exchange- Traded | Equity
|Derivatives, Notional Amount
|Derivative assets
|404
|371
|Derivative liabilities
|460
|602
|Not designated as accounting hedges | Exchange- Traded | Commodity and other
|Derivatives, Notional Amount
|Derivative assets
|70
|67
|Derivative liabilities
|$ 66
|$ 65
|X
- Definition
+ References
Nominal or face amount used to calculate payments on the derivative asset.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Nominal or face amount used to calculate payments on the derivative liability.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- References
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details